Our Testing Methodology: The Host-Target Approach
We utilize a sophisticated Host-Target architecture to automate and standardize the validation process:
- On-Board Test Software: We develop dedicated, high-performance test firmware that resides on the target controller (e.g., TMS570).
- Host GUI Control: A custom-built Graphical User Interface on a Host Computer drives the testing sequence via RS422/RS232 communication.
- Real-Time Diagnostics: The system executes a “Stimulus-Response” loop, reporting real-time status and clear Pass/Fail results back to the GUI for audit logging.
Peripherals & Interface Coverage
Our validation suites exercise the full capabilities of your hardware, ensuring that both on-chip peripherals and on-board communication controllers are fully functional.
1. On-Chip Logic & Memory Validation
We perform deep-dive testing of the microcontroller’s internal architecture, including:
- Safety Features: VIM (Vectored Interrupt Manager) and PBIST (Programmable Built-In Self-Test).
- Memory Integrity: Comprehensive R/W stress tests for SRAM, FRAM, and internal Flash.
- I/O Control: Validation of GPIO, I2C, and SPI protocols for sensor and peripheral communication.
2. Aerospace Communication Controllers
Verification of mission-critical data buses to ensure zero-loss communication:
- ARINC 429: Protocol validation, label filtering, and timing accuracy.
- MIL-STD-1553B: Remote Terminal (RT) and Bus Controller (BC) functional testing.
- USB & High-Speed I/O: Signal integrity and data throughput validation for external interfaces.
